+
+;;
+;; ....................
+;;
+;; FLOATING POINT SCALE
+;;
+;; ....................
+(define_insn "ldexp<mode>3"
+ [(set (match_operand:ANYF 0 "register_operand" "=f")
+ (unspec:ANYF [(match_operand:ANYF 1 "register_operand" "f")
+ (match_operand:<IMODE> 2 "register_operand" "f")]
+ UNSPEC_FSCALEB))]
+ "TARGET_HARD_FLOAT"
+ "fscaleb.<fmt>\t%0,%1,%2"
+ [(set_attr "type" "fscaleb")
+ (set_attr "mode" "<UNITMODE>")])

new file mode 100644
@@ -0,0 +1,48 @@
+/* { dg-do compile } */
+/* { dg-options "-O2 -mabi=lp64d -mdouble-float -fno-math-errno" } */
+/* { dg-final { scan-assembler-times "fscaleb\\.s" 3 } } */
+/* { dg-final { scan-assembler-times "fscaleb\\.d" 4 } } */
+/* { dg-final { scan-assembler-times "slli\\.w" 1 } } */
+
+double
+my_scalbln (double a, long b)
+{
+ return __builtin_scalbln (a, b);
+}
+
+double
+my_scalbn (double a, int b)
+{
+ return __builtin_scalbn (a, b);
+}
+
+double
+my_ldexp (double a, int b)
+{
+ return __builtin_ldexp (a, b);
+}
+
+float
+my_scalblnf (float a, long b)
+{
+ return __builtin_scalblnf (a, b);
+}
+
+float
+my_scalbnf (float a, int b)
+{
+ return __builtin_scalbnf (a, b);
+}
+
+float
+my_ldexpf (float a, int b)
+{
+ return __builtin_ldexpf (a, b);
+}
+
+/* b must be sign-extended */
+double
+my_ldexp_long (double a, long b)
+{
+ return __builtin_ldexp (a, b);
+}
